Documentation pour la conception de base de données
Comment pouvons-nous vous aider ?
Recherche sur tout le site

Valeurs par défaut

Configurer une valeur par défaut

Dans certains cas, vous pouvez avoir besoin que Ragic remplisse certains de vos champs avec une Valeur par défaut, telle que l'heure ou la date actuelle, vous permettant de gagner du temps lorsque vous remplissez vos entrées et/ou tout simplement pour éviter des erreurs lors de saisies manuelles.

Pour définir les valeurs par défaut pour les types de champ les prenant en charge, il faut être dans le mode design et cliquer sur le lien à côté de l'option Valeur par défaut sous le menu Paramètres du champ > Basique.

Variables disponibles

Vous pouvez utiliser les variables proposées dans Ragic pour générer une valeur par défaut lors de la création ou de la mise à jour d'une entrée. Vous pouvez également écrire une valeur définie comme par défaut qui remplira ce champ pour chaque nouvelle entrée, notamment dans le cas de la configuration d'un champ Texte libre ou Sélection.

Valeur par défaut Mise en forme Variable Exemple
Créer une date aaaa/MM/jj $DATE 2015/05/19
Créer une heure HH:mm:ss $TIME 09:21:05
Créer date et heure aaaa/MM/jj HH:mm:ss $DATETIME 2015/05/10 09:21:05
Créer une année aaaa $YEAR 2015
Créer un mois M $MONTH 5
Créer un jour de la semaine E $WEEKDAY 2
Créer un nom d'utilisateur Prénom Nom $USERNAME Jane Doe
Créer un e-mail d'utilisateur email@domain.com $USERID jane@initech.com
Date de la dernière modification yyyy/MM/dd #DATE 2015/05/23
Heure de la dernière modification HH:mm:ss #TIME 09:32:06
Date et heure de la dernière modification aaaa/MM/jj HH:mm:ss #DATETIME 2015/05/23 09:32:06
Année de la dernière modification aaaa #YEAR 2015
Mois de la dernière modification M #MONTH 5
Jour de la semaine de la dernière modification E #WEEKDAY 2
Dernière modification du nom d'utilisateur Prénom Nom #USERNAME Karen Moore
Dernière modification de l'e-mail d'utilisateur email@domain.com #USERID karen@initech.com
Séquence 1,2,3 $SEQ 3

Pour ce qui est des valeurs à "créer", si des valeurs par défaut sont ajoutées à un enregistrement qui existe déjà, celles-ci seront déclenchées au moment de l'édition ou de l'ajout de l'enregistrement. Toutefois, si le champ est vide, il enregistra les coordonnées de l'utilisateur l'ayant édité et le temps de l'édition, plutôt que celles de son créateur originel ainsi que son temps de création. Pour éviter cette situation, il est recommandé de remplir manuellement les valeurs vides afin de récupérer les informations de création d'origine.

Entrer votre propre format de mise en forme pour les valeurs par défaut

Si vous avez besoin d'une mise en forme personnalisée pour des valeurs par défaut, vous pouvez saisir du texte dans la boîte de formatage située sous les options de Valeur par défaut, ou simplement choisir parmi les options de mise en forme pré-sélectionnées. Vous avez également la possibilité de définir un format de date personnalisé pour les champs de date.

Appliquer des formules

Vous pouvez également appliquer des formules à une valeur par défaut. Depuis la Page formulaire, allez dans le Mode design et cochez la case Interpréter comme une formule en dessous du champ Valeur par défaut. Vous pouvez maintenant ajouter votre formule directement dans le champ Valeur par défaut. Pour un aperçu des formules prises en charge dans Ragic, veuillez consulter la documentation suivante.

Remarques

Les formules dans le champ de valeur par défaut ne seront interprétées que lorsque le champ de référence sera modifié pour la première fois. Une fois qu'une formule est interprétée, elle ne sera plus recalculée en fonction de modifications ultérieures. Si vous souhaitez que la valeur par défaut soit mise à jour en fonction du champ de référence, veuillez utiliser des formules plutôt que d'ajouter une formule en tant que valeur par défaut. Les formules sont expliquées en détail dans ce document.

Pour une raison similaire, Ragic n'autorise pas l'utilisation de formules dans le champ de valeur par défaut lorsque l'une de ces formules fait référence à plusieurs champs et que vous activez lasauvegarde automatique dans une feuille. En effet, quand elle est activée, la formule sera interprétée lorsqu'un des champs de référence est sauvegardé automatiquement, mais ne sera pas recalculée quand d'autres champs sont édités

Utilisation avec le mode de lecture seule

Les champs avec des valeurs par défaut sont souvent utilisés avec l'option En lecture seule pour empêcher toute modification manuelle de la valeur par les utilisateurs.

Remplir les valeurs vides

Lorsque votre feuille contient déjà des entrées et que vous souhaitez ajouter un nouveau champ avec une valeur par défaut, ou modifier un champ existant en un type de champ qui a une valeur par défaut, Ragic ne va pas automatiquement remplir l'entrée existante avec la valeur par défaut d'après la configuration que vous venez de définir. Par conséquent, il est possible que le nouveau champ ou le champ récemment modifié reste vide. Pour attribuer une valeur par défaut à toutes les valeurs vides, pouvant être par exemple, la mise à jour la plus récente, vous pouvez cliquer sur le bouton Remplir les valeurs vides sous l'option Valeur par défautdans le mode design.

Etape 1. Se rendre dans le mode design pour définir votre valeur par défaut

Etape 2. Sauvegarder vos modifications

Etape 3. Sous l'option Valeur par défaut, cliquer sur le champ de définition de la valeur par défaut. Ensuite, cliquer sur Remplir les valeurs vides.

Une fois que vous avez cliqué sur le bouton Remplir les valeurs vides, Ragic commencera en arrière-plan à remplir les valeurs vides. Cela peut prendre un certain temps en fonction du nombre d'enregistrements de votre feuille. N'hésitez pas à quitter le mode design si vous en avez envie. Vous recevrez une notification contextuelle dans le coin inférieur gauche de votre écran une fois que le processus sera terminé.

Vous verrez ensuite la ou les valeurs par défaut remplies automatiquement sur la page formulaire.

Haut de page Table des matières

Start Ragic for Free

Sign up with Google